The Westin Indianapolis enjoys an unbeatable location in the heart of the city. Connected by a covered sky-bridge to the Indiana Convention Center, Lucas Oil Stadium and Circle Center Mall, guests have access to everything they need, whether traveling for business or leisure. We are only a short walk from area attractions like the Conseco Field House, Victory Field and the NCAA Hall of Champions. Relax and let our concierge make your reservations or enjoy an in-room meal from Shula's Steakhouse, ranked among North America's Top Ten Steak Houses. Enjoy a peaceful night in our signature Heavenly Bed, and revive in the morning with our in room coffee maker complete with complimentary Starbucks coffee. Discover the transformation at The Westin Indianapolis. Our $6.5M renovation features updated ballrooms and breakout rooms with a new sound system, lighting, vinyl walls, carpeting, and reader boards. Our meeting spaces are perfect for any event, and our staff will be happy to help you organize the perfect function. Try out Westin Guest Office rooms, with extra business amenities allowing you to keep up with work while away.

Lack of extras really added up!

Nickled, Dimed and 10's of dollared Sep 21, 2009

The Weston was clean and comfortable. Staff helpful. Main issue was that nothing was included with the room price. Want to ... park your car while a guest at the hotel? That will be $28 per day, thank you! Want to get from the airport to the hotel? No problem! That will be $35 by cab, $25 by shared limo or if you are lucky and it is running, $7 by Green Line GoIndy bus. All prices are ONE WAY. As I was waiting for my shared limo, I watched many, many downtown hotel shuttles come and go from the airport, so Weston's competition is providing for their guests. Want a bottle of water in your hotel room? $3.50 please! And you may indeed want that bottle of water - the water coming out of the tap was foul the weekend I was there. Want to use the Hotel WIFI in your hotel room? $5.95 per day, thank you. If you want to save a little dough, the WIFI is free in the lobby. Want to get a turkey club sent to your room because you arrived after the hotel resturant closed at 10 pm? No problem, that will be $28, plus a $3.50 room delivery charge! All of this at a hotel where I spent just over $100/night for the room. My Advice: Before you book a room at a Weston Hotel, find out just how much it is REALLY going to cost you to stay there.

Good Location...Steep Parking

francescaoh Jul 15, 2009

Good location, like other downtown hotels. Can walk to everything, including Zoo, stadiums, mall, more. However, the ... parking was the most expensive we saw in the whole downtown ($25/day with no in/out), and the hallways were dirty, need painted, etc. Rooms fine, lobbies fine, but the corridors were kind of icky feeling. Also, the showers have NO non-skid coating on them -- extremely slippery. Our 5 year-old fell twice while just standing and trying to take a shower. Also, they charge $10/day for internet. Seriously, for the cost of the room, why aren't they up to par with free wireless? Would recommend downtown, but check out deals at other hotels first. Also, room service is very expensive -- walk outside and do something else. Nobody should pay $12 for a bowl of cereal!
